Crushing Hammer (Japanese: クラッシュハンマー Crush Hammer) is an Item card. It was first released as part of the Emerging Powers expansion.

Release information

This card was included in the Emerging Powers expansion with artwork by 5ban Graphics, first released in the Japanese Black Collection. It was reprinted in the Japanese Battle Theme Deck: Victini, the Master Deck Build Box EX, and the Mewtwo Half Deck in the Mewtwo vs Genesect Deck Kit. It was later released in the English Legendary Treasures expansion.

Crushing Hammer was reprinted during the XY Series in the Kalos Starter Set with new artwork by 5ban Graphics, first released in the Japanese XY Beginning Set. This print was later included in the Japanese Yveltal Half Deck, in the English Generations expansion, and in the Japanese BREAK Starter Pack.

During the Sun & Moon Series, Crushing Hammer was reprinted again with new artwork by Yoshinobu Saito. It was included in the Sun & Moon expansion, first released simultaneously in the Japanese Collection Sun and Sun & Moon Starter Set on December 9, 2016. In Japan, it was later released as part of the Team Rocket Half Deck in the Ash vs Team Rocket Deck Kit and again in the Ultra Moon expansion as both a Regular and Full Art Secret card. The Secret print was later released in the English Ultra Prism expansion and features artwork by Yoshinobu Saito. In Japan, the Sun & Moon print was later included in 3 of the GX Starter Decks and in the Tag Team GX Deck Build Box.

Crushing Hammer was reprinted again during the Sword & Shield Series as part of the Sword & Shield expansion, first released in the Japanese V Starter Set Fire and Water. This print has new artwork by sadaji. In Japan, it was reprinted again in two of the nine V Starter Decks and in the Blastoise VMAX Starter Set.

Trivia

This card's effect matches that of Energy Removal 2.
